Lenovo Group Ltd is poised to purchase Google's (NASDAQ:GOOG) Motorola Mobility business, an acquisition that would expand the Chinese company's footprint in the lucrative tablet and smartphone markets, according to reports.

The purchase, said to be worth at least 3 billion, will include more than 10,000 mobile communications patents currently held by Google, according to a report in the China Daily, which cited a person familiar with the matter.

Web site TechCruch said it had confirmed reports of the acquisition.

Lenovo, the world's largest manufacturer of PCs, is expected to announce the deal on Thursday morning in Beijing.

Lenovo declined to comment on specifics, telling the Chinese newspaper Thursday's announcement is related to a major acquisition.

A Google spokesman didn't immediately respond to a request for comment.

Lenovo hopes the acquisition will help it keep up in the global gadgets arms race with competitors Apple (NASDAQ:AAPL) and Samsung Electronics.

Motorola Mobility, which Google acquired in 2011 for about 12.5 billion, reported a 248 million operating loss in the third quarter of 2013, according to Google's financial report.
